we are just tuning a v6 vs with twin throttlebodys and want to swap the maf over into one intake going to one throttle body so we can run 2 pod filters and intakes im wondering if maf frequency is directly proportionate to flow .im wondering if doubling the grms per second vs frequency in the maf tables will work to get it in a rough area for further tuning

Hey delcowizzid,

i can't remember if they are, but I would recommend you run a balance pipe between the two pipes to insure that you get equal volume flow rate between the two such that MAF signal will still be accurate even if the filters get blocked etc.

Doubling everything should work, but it's going to favour the throttle with no maf on it a bit so it might still need some adjusting

Yeah I can't see why not, they are just in grams per second, has to work :), I did a tune for a VT 5 litre the other day, he wanted the cruise 10% leaner (has a wide band) I've got no clue where the lean cruise section of the tune is so I just guestamated how many cfm/grams per second a 5 litre would use at cruise and took 10% off the maf tables:p in that area don't know if the plan worked or not yet but will soon
